ADHD Stimulant Medication

Stimulant medication is the initial treatment of choice for ADHD. They have a long history of a robust response, high tolerance, and safety over the lifespan.

psychology-today-logo.pngIt's crucial to choose the right dosage and medication that alleviates your child's or your own symptoms without causing any adverse side negative effects. This usually requires many trials and error, as well as open communication with your doctor.

Stimulants

Stimulants are drugs which increase the activity of the central nervous system. They are frequently used for stimulants for cognitive enhancement and performance by students, athletes as well as artists and workers. They are also employed for treating attention deficit hyperactivity disorder (ADHD) and eating disorders that cause binge eating, and other anxiety disorders. The most popular stimulant drugs are amphetamines and methylphenidates.

FDA-approved prescription stimulants come in both extended-release and immediate-release formulations. The immediate-release medications are typically taken every 4 hours. If they are not taken as often, they can cause a sudden and short-term decrease in energy. The crash can result in extreme hunger, mood swings, and fatigue. Immediate-release medications also can increase blood pressure and heart rate in certain people, particularly when they don't eat enough.

Extended-release medicines are formulated to release active ingredients over the course of 8-16 hours. Your doctor may suggest this kind of medication if you are looking for long-lasting control of symptoms without having to take a pill multiple times per day.
